In order to make our website more attractive and to enable certain functions to display relevant products or for market research purposes, we use so-called cookies on our sites. The above - as part of the analysis and evaluation of interests - serves to protect our legitimate interest of optimal presentation of our offerings. Cookies are small text files that are automatically stored on your terminal device. Some of the cookies we use are deleted when the browser session ends, i.e. after it is closed (so-called session cookies). Other cookies are stored on your terminal device and allow us to recognize your browser the next time you visit the site (persistent cookies). The storage time is specified in the cookie settings of your web browser. You can configure your browser to receive information about the use of cookies and be able to decide whether to accept or reject them in certain cases or completely. Browsers manage cookie settings in different ways. In the help menu of your web browser you will find explanations on how to change your cookie settings.

On our website, so-called social plug-ins ("plug-ins") of social networks are used. By displaying our website containing such a plug-in, your browser will establish a direct connection to Facebook, Google, Twitter or Instagram servers. The content of the plug-in is transmitted by the respective service provider directly to your browser and integrated into the site. Thanks to this integration, service providers receive information that your browser has viewed our site, even if you do not have a profile with the given service provider or are not logged in with him at the moment. Such information (along with your IP address) is sent by your browser directly to the server of the given service provider (some servers are located in the USA) and stored there. If you have logged in to one of the social networks, this service provider will be able to directly attribute your visit to our site to your profile on the respective social network. If you use a particular plug-in, such as clicking on the "Like" button or the "Share" button, the corresponding information will also be sent directly to the server of the respective service provider and stored there. This information will besides be published in the respective social network and will appear to the people added as your contacts. The purpose and scope of data collection and its further processing and use by service providers, as well as the possibility of contacting you and your rights in this regard and the possibility of making settings to ensure the protection of your privacy are described in the service providers' privacy policies. http://www.facebook.com/policy.phpIf you do not want social networking sites to attribute the data collected during your visit to our website directly to your profile on the respective site, then you must log out of that site before visiting our site. You can also completely prevent plug-ins from loading on the site by using appropriate extensions for your browser, such as blocking scripts with "NoScript" (http://noscript.net/)."
